The vapor is flammable, and it's acting as the fuel for the flame.These butter candles burned for 4 hours each, giving a total of 8 hours of heat and light from the original bar.
Note:  After a couple of hours, the butter warms up to the point where it melts and the wick may fall over.  In this case, it's useful to take a paperclip and make a support for the wick.  To do this from the beginning, just insert the wick and paperclip together from the bottom of the butter block.
